Ablation devices are medical instruments used to eliminate abnormal tissue growths or dysfunctional cells, such as tumors or cardiac arrhythmias, employing various energy sources such as heat, cold, or radiofrequency. These devices play a crucial role in minimally invasive procedures aimed at treating conditions ranging from cancer to heart rhythm disorders.
The primary types of ablation devices include laser ablators, radiofrequency ablators, microwave ablators, ultrasound ablators, electric ablators, hydrothermal ablators, and cryoablators. Laser ablators utilize laser energy for precise material removal or modification, commonly applied in industrial settings. The technology encompasses various methods such as radiofrequency ablation, microwave ablation, cryoablation, high-intensity focused ultrasound, laser interstitial thermal ablation, and others, often incorporating automated and robotic functionalities. These devices are utilized by diverse end-users including hospitals, clinics, ambulatory surgical centers, and others.

The ablation devices market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$9.25 billion in 2025 to $10.12 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.5%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to increasing prevalence of cancer treatment procedures, rising adoption of ablation in cardiac arrhythmia management, growth in hospital installation of radiofrequency and laser ablation systems, expanding clinical acceptance of minimally invasive therapy alternatives, increasing usage of cryoablation and microwave ablation in specialty care.
The ablation devices market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$14.02 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.5%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to rising demand for precision targeted tissue ablation technologies, growing adoption of robotic and automatic ablation systems, expansion of ablation applications across multiple therapeutic areas, increasing investment in outpatient and ambulatory surgical infrastructure, rising preference for minimally invasive procedures with faster recovery. Major trends in the forecast period include increasing adoption of minimally invasive ablation procedures across oncology and cardiology, rising utilization of radiofrequency and microwave ablation systems for targeted tissue destruction, growing preference for cryoablation and hydrothermal ablation in specialized clinical applications, expanding clinical use of laser and ultrasound ablation devices for precision therapeutic outcomes, increasing deployment of ablation technologies in ambulatory and outpatient surgical settings.
The rising incidence of cancer is anticipated to drive the growth of the microwave ablation devices market in the coming years. Cancer is a condition characterized by the uncontrolled growth of abnormal cells that can spread to other parts of the body. The increase in cancer cases is largely attributed to longer life expectancy, which raises the risk of age-related diseases such as cancer. Microwave ablation devices are used in cancer treatment by emitting electromagnetic waves that generate heat to destroy tumor cells. This targeted and minimally invasive technique helps preserve surrounding healthy tissue and supports faster patient recovery. For example, in February 2024, according to the World Health Organization, a Switzerland-based intergovernmental organization, more than 35 million new cancer cases were projected by 2050, representing a 77% increase compared to the estimated 20 million cases reported in 2022. As a result, the growing number of cancer cases is fueling the expansion of the microwave ablation devices market.
Major companies operating in the microwave ablation devices market are emphasizing the development of advanced products with regulatory approvals, such as high-precision microwave ablation systems, to enhance patient outcomes in minimally invasive cancer treatments. A high-precision microwave ablation system is an advanced medical device that uses focused microwave energy to accurately destroy tumor tissue. It delivers controlled heat to targeted areas while minimizing damage to adjacent healthy structures, thereby improving safety and treatment effectiveness. For instance, in January 2024, Hygea Medical Technology Co. Ltd., a China-based medical device manufacturer, received approval from the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for its EXCEED microwave treatment system and EXACT series microwave ablation probes. This approval followed prior clearance from China's National Medical Products Administration (NMPA) and was obtained through an expedited review process. The FDA clearance confirms the safety, performance, and quality of Hygea's products for the treatment of various solid tumors in soft tissues, marking a key milestone in the company's international expansion, particularly in the U.S. microwave ablation market. This system complements existing cancer therapies by providing a high-precision, minimally invasive thermal ablation solution.
In July 2024, Creo Medical Group plc, a UK-based manufacturer of flexible microwave ablation devices, entered into a partnership with Intuitive Surgical Inc. to advance minimally invasive lung cancer treatment. The collaboration is intended to integrate Creo's MicroBlate Flex and Kamaptive technologies with Intuitive's Ion Endoluminal System, supporting expanded clinical studies and improving precision in lung cancer diagnosis and ablation across the UK and Europe. Intuitive Surgical Inc. is a US-based provider of minimally invasive care and a pioneer in robotic surgery.
